Changeset 264


Ignore:
Timestamp:
Apr 7, 2019, 7:10:40 PM (6 years ago)
Author:
roby
Message:
 
Location:
trunk/admin/modules/Elezioni
Files:
3 edited

Legend:

Unmodified
Added
Removed
  • trunk/admin/modules/Elezioni/ele_colora_sez.php

    r263 r264  
    1515        $res->execute();       
    1616        }else{ #candidati
    17         $sql="SELECT count(t2.id_lista) FROM ".$prefix."_ele_voti_candidati as t1 left join ".$prefix."_ele_candidati as t2 on t1.id_cand=t2.id_cand where t1.id_cons='$id_cons' and t1.id_sez='$id_sez' group by t2.id_lista";
     17        $sql="SELECT t2.id_lista FROM ".$prefix."_ele_voti_candidati as t1 left join ".$prefix."_ele_candidati as t2 on t1.id_cand=t2.id_cand where t1.id_cons='$id_cons' and t1.id_sez='$id_sez' group by t2.id_lista";
    1818        $res = $dbi->prepare("$sql");
    1919        $res->execute();
    20         list($liste)=$res->fetch(PDO::FETCH_NUM);
     20        $liste=$res->rowCount();
    2121       
    2222        $sql="SELECT count(id_lista) FROM ".$prefix."_ele_lista where id_cons='$id_cons'";
  • trunk/admin/modules/Elezioni/ele_voti.php

    r262 r264  
    687687
    688688                if($id_lista) {
    689                         while(list($id_cand,$id_cons2,$id_lista2, $cognome, $nome, $note, $simbolo, $num_cand) = $result->fetch(PDO::FETCH_NUM)){
     689                        while(list($id_cand,$id_cons2,$id_lista2,$nl, $cognome, $nome, $note, $simbolo, $num_cand) = $result->fetch(PDO::FETCH_NUM)){
    690690                                // dati lista
    691691                                $sql="select id_lista, descrizione,simbolo,num_lista from ".$prefix."_ele_lista where id_lista='$id_lista2'";
  • trunk/admin/modules/Elezioni/salva_liste.php

    r262 r264  
    5151global $prefix,$id_parz,$fileout;
    5252if($id_lista){
    53         $sql="select num_cand from ".$prefix."_ele_candidati where id_cons='$id_cons' and id_lista='$id_lista' ORDER BY num_cand  ";
     53        $sql="select num_cand,id_cand from ".$prefix."_ele_candidati where id_cons='$id_cons' and id_lista='$id_lista' ORDER BY num_cand  ";
    5454        $result = $dbi->prepare("$sql");
    5555        $result->execute();
    56         while(list($i)=$result->fetch(PDO::FETCH_BOTH)) {
     56        while(list($i,$y)=$result->fetch(PDO::FETCH_NUM)) {
    5757                $vot="voti$i";$cand="id_cand$i";
    58                 if (isset($_GET[$cand])) $idcand[$i]=intval($_GET[$cand]); else $idcand[$i]='0';
     58                if (isset($_GET[$cand])) $idcand[$i]=intval($_GET[$cand]); else $idcand[$i]=$y;
    5959                if (isset($_GET[$vot])) $voti[$i]=intval($_GET[$vot]); else $voti[$i]='0';
    6060        #       if (isset($_GET[$solo])) $solog[$i]=intval($_GET[$solo]); else $solog[$i]='0';
     
    6666        $result->execute();
    6767        $sololiste=0;
    68         while(list($i)=$result->fetch(PDO::FETCH_BOTH)) {
     68        while(list($i)=$result->fetch(PDO::FETCH_NUM)) {
    6969                $vot="voti$i";$vnp="vnpl$i";$slp="slpl$i";$idlist="id_lista$i";
    7070                if (isset($_GET[$vnp])) $vnpl[$i]=intval($_GET[$vnp]); else $vnpl[$i]='0';
     
    101101               
    102102        }elseif($id_lista){
    103                 $sql="SELECT disgiunto FROM ".$prefix."_ele_cons_comune where id_cons='$id_cons' ";
    104                 $res = $dbi->prepare("$sql");
    105                 $res->execute();
    106                 list($disgiunto)=$res->fetch(PDO::FETCH_NUM);
    107                 if($disgiunto){
    108                 }
    109                 foreach($idcand as $idkey=>$idc){
    110                        
     103                foreach($idcand as $idkey=>$idc){                       
    111104                        $sql="select num_cand from ".$prefix."_ele_voti_candidati where id_sez='$id_sez' and id_cand='$idc'";
    112105                        $result = $dbi->prepare("$sql");
Note: See TracChangeset for help on using the changeset viewer.